Brandon Lee Mojica v. United States

Paid petition · United States Court of Appeals for the Eleventh Circuit, No. 19-10198 · judgment April 3, 2019


Certiorari denied · January 13, 2020
Pre-decision estimate: 3% cert probability

Before the decision, well below the 4.1% base rate, with no standout signals pointing toward a grant.

Questions presented

  1. Whether the Court should grant, vacate, and remand this case to the Eleventh Circuit for reconsideration in light of United States v. Davis, 2019 WL 2570623 (2019).

  2. Does a defendant have to plead at a heightened standard and prove his allegations before being granted an evidentiary hearing under 28 U.S.C. § 2255.
